Taxonomic Classification

Rank Broad-muzzled Bat Gabon Talapoin
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Primates (Primates)
Family Vespertilionidae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ys)
Genus Submyotodon Miopithecus
Species Submyotodon latirostris Miopithecus ogouensis

Evolutionary Relationship

Broad-muzzled Bat and Gabon Talapoin share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
